In the autumn of 1986, a tragic event unfolded in the waters near Juneau, Alaska, leading to the disappearance of 38-year-old Tom R. Kelly. On October 30, 1986, Kelly, along with two other men, William Scott Lewis and William 'Bill' Tugman, were aboard the fishing vessel Danube. The group was on a crabbing trip in the Gastineau Channel in the vicinity of Marmion Island when they encountered a boating accident.
